Transaction ab7920c0b75a808f514953209a359f89ccc27d7dccbd8b042b8e858d2fce4cdd

1 Input
1 Outputs
  • ab7920c0b75a808f514953209a359f89ccc27d7dccbd8b042b8e858d2fce4cdd:0
  • value  20768946
    address  36XWTfSYJJz3WSNPZVZ3q3aa5eFuJHR9nu